CAN Controller Interrupt Handling
Figure 36-10. Possible Initialization Procedure
There are two different types of interrupts. One type of interrupt is a message-object related
interrupt, the other is a system interrupt that handles errors or system-related interrupt sources.
All interrupt sources can be masked by writing the corresponding field in the CAN_IDR register.
They can be unmasked by writing to the CAN_IER register. After a power-up reset, all interrupt
sources are disabled (masked). The current mask status can be checked by reading the
CAN_IMR register.
The CAN_SR register gives all interrupt source states.
The following events may initiate one of the two interrupts:
• Message object interrupt
• System interrupts
